Are you a dedicated scientist eager to advance our understanding of hydroclimatic extremes across past, present, and future climates? Are you motivated by the opportunity to contribute to high-impact science and become a recognised expert within UKCEH and the wider national and international research community?

In this role, you will contribute to a portfolio of national and international science initiatives, including the Co-Centre for Climate + Biodiversity + Water and CANARI projects and related flagship National Capability projects such as the UK Hydrological Outlook and our International Programme . You will be working on developing future projections of hydrological extremes using large ensembles, including advancing understanding of the associated variability and uncertainty. You will also contribute to the co-development and delivery of products and tools that enable water managers to assess the impacts of climate change on water systems and support efforts to enhance resilience against future extreme hazards. This is a rewarding opportunity to see our research translated into applied tools which have a positive impact on our society.

You’ll join a multidisciplinary team of hydrologists, climate scientists, and data scientists, collaborating across diverse areas of research and professional development . Your role includes leading tasks within concurrent research projects, initiating and organising work independently as well as working within a team . You’ll also help communicate the value of your science and UKCEH’s work both internally and externally, supporting knowledge exchange and stakeholder engagement.

Your main responsibilities will include:

  • Investigating historical trends, drivers of variability, and characteristics of droughts, and assess ing their current and future impacts across the UK and wider European region.

  • Developing and analysing hydroclimate datasets, including large ensemble future hydrological projections, while ensuring good data management practices of large datasets.

  • Developing and testing novel approaches to quantifying and attributing risk, including ‘storyline s ’ approaches , UNSEEN and other emerging techniques .

  • Contributing to significant outputs each year (e.g., peer refereed publications or reports , scientific models and methods , published datasets etc . ) and leading where necessary.

  • Collaborating with internal UKCEH researchers, and external partners and engaging with key stakeholders, including water companies, government agencies and a wide range of water managers
